Leveraging existing IT infrastructure

Using the EnOcean IoT Connector in conjunction with already existing IT infrastructure – such as IP Access Points or Gateways capable of receiving EnOcean radio telegrams – provides a cost-effective IoT solution as it eliminates the need for a dedicated IoT data network. An example of such setup is described in detail here.

EnOcean provides a simple, low-cost USB stick that can be plugged into suitable Access Points or Gateways enabling them to receive and transmit EnOcean radio telegrams.

EnOcean-enabled Access Points or Gateways can simply forward all received EnOcean radio telegrams to the EnOcean IoT Connector using a secure network tunnel running on top of the existing network connection. There is no need for any local data processing which keeps the local SW complexity at a minimum.

The EnOcean IoT Connector

The EnOcean IoT Connector implements all required security and data processing functionality to transform received radio telegram data into easy-to-use sensor data in standardized JSON format which is then provided to the end application.

The EnOcean IoT connector is delivered as ready-to-use SW package (Docker container) that can run on a wide variety of platforms ranging from low-cost computing platforms, dedicated on-premises servers to Azure or AWS cloud deployments.

The EnOcean IoT Connector is a software that is available as a Docker container image. A container is a standard unit of software and can be deployed and run anywhere.

  • Output and deployment: Easy adoption by IoT clouds
    Customer applications consume IoT data in a „key-value pair“ format, like JSON. One key feature of the IoT Connector software is that it decodes the IoT data from EnOcean protocol and translates it into ready-to-use data in JSON format to be used in the actual application.
  • Management API: The Management API onboards the sensors
    Sensors are easy to onboard and to commission via the app EnOcean Tool using NFC, a web interface or directly with our Management API.

The EnOcean IoT Connector is provided as a license with an annual subscription. You select how many EnOcean devices your license does include, that directly defines how many devices your IoT Connector instance will process. It is this easy, just choose how many EnOcean devices will be deployed in your IoT project.
